Menu item setting

c

Noise Suppress Level Setting
[Noise Suppress: 1 to 10]
Screen noise can be reduced with the Detail Level
Setting at High or Low. If the noise suppress level is set
too high, a fine object will be reproduced less sharply.

d

Level Dependent Level Setting
[Level Dependent: 0% to 25%]
Screen noise due to the detail of dark parts of an object
can be reduced.
If level dependent level is set too high, however, hair, for
example, will be reproduced less sharply.

e

Dark Detail Level Setting [Dark Detail: 0 to 5]
The contours of the darker portions of an object can be
emphasized.
This setting is possible only when the Level Dependent
Level Setting is set to 0%.

f

Chroma Detail Level Setting [Chroma Detail: 0 to 15]
The contours of high-hue portions of an object can be
emphasized.

g

Flesh Noise Suppress Level Setting
[Flesh Noise Sup.: OFF, Low, High]
Flesh noise is suppressed in two steps when the Detail
Level Setting is at High or Low.

h

Precision Detail Level Setting
[Precision Detail: OFF, Low, High]
This setting is to narrow detail width and suppress detail
glare.
